UEFA EURO 2024 activity book launched with Libraries Ireland

The Football Association of Ireland is proud to continue its collaboration with Libraries Ireland and Monaghan County Libraries by launching an engaging UEFA EURO 2024 Activity Book, aimed at inspiring young football enthusiasts across Ireland.

This initiative aims to foster a love for football while promoting literacy and learning through interactive activities. The UEFA EURO 2024 Activity Book, designed in collaboration with Monaghan County Libraries, combines the excitement of the European Championships with educational content tailored for children. 

With puzzles, quizzes, and fun facts about football and European culture, the activity book promises to captivate young minds and encourage learning in a dynamic and enjoyable way.

FAI Grassroots Director, Ger McDermott, said: "We're thrilled yet again to team up with Libraries Ireland and in particular, Monaghan County Libraries to introduce this Euro 2024 Activity Book. Football has a unique ability to bring people together, and through this initiative, we aim to inspire young fans while promoting literacy and learning. This partnership with the Monaghan County Libraries represents our commitment to engaging with young readers nationwide in a fun and meaningful way, combining their passion for football with valuable educational content."

FAI Schools and Third Level Programme Coordinator Colin Clerkin said: ‘’The launch of this EURO 2024 Activity Book aligns with the upcoming UEFA European Championships, offering children the perfect opportunity to immerse themselves in the excitement of the tournament while honing their literacy skills. This continued partnership with Monaghan County Libraries reflects the FAI's commitment to reach communities nationwide and promote both football and literacy as essential pillars of childhood development. We have also incorporated a segment on the UEFA Europa League Final as we look forward to hosting the final this year.’’
